

Encryption software can help businesses comply with legal and industry standards and restriction.On the other hand, companies benefit several ways in encrypting their business data. Aside from making it harder for intruders to get in corporate networks, encrypting data will make it more costly in terms of time and effort for thieves to gain from their loot. The implementation of encryption software is an excellent cybersecurity strategy that complements solutions to protect IT resources and digital assets. Although they cannot prevent theft or unauthorized interception, the software makes it difficult for third parties to readily take advantage of data they have stolen. They can also protect data in transit to secure data communications between endpoints. Today’s encryption tools can protect stored data or data at rest such as individual files, directories, whole hard disks or selected partitions or volumes. Using varying degrees of cipher algorithms, it can encrypt or encode data containing sensitive information and make it unreadable to anyone or any device without the proper key to decode it back to its readable state. What is encryption software?Įncryption software is a program that converts readable information into unreadable or unintelligible data.
